Former Union minister and ex BJP rebel leader Yashwant Sinha recently took a sarcastic dig at PM Narendra Modi-led NDA government and said that he was “wrong in criticising demonetization.” Continuing his tirade against the Central government he took another swipe at it and said, “It (demonetisation) has completely stopped stone pelting in Kashmir and ended black money in India and Switzerland?”

Sinha’s latest critique on the Modi government came after the annual data by Swiss National Bank (SNB) revealed that money parked by Indians in Swiss banks rose over 50 per cent to CHF 1.01 billion (Rs 7,000 crore) in 2017.

Yashwant Sinha has been an ardent critic of the demonetisation move. In fact, last year September, he had said that demonetisation and the implementation of the Goods and Services Tax (GST) were badly timed. Sinha had also alleged that the NDA government is confused that development can be attained through welfare schemes.

Earlier on Friday, a day after the latest data from the Swiss National Bank was released West Bengal CM Mamata Banerjee took a swipe at Narendra Modi-led Central government. In a suggestive tweet, hinting at demonetisation being the reason of the money rising in Swiss bank, she wrote:

"Bravo! #DeMonetisation?...Swiss Bank money flying. India losing."

Congress President Rahul Gandhi also took a jibe at PM Modi and said that after the revelation by Swiss National Bank’s data, Modi will say, “50% jump in Swiss Bank deposits by Indians, is "WHITE" money. No "BLACK" in Swiss Banks!”

Furthermore, on Saturday, in an ironical twist to the Vijay Mallya case, the liquor baron who is currently being stared at by a fugitive economic offender tag, has retweeted Congress President Rahul Gandhi’s tweet, attacking government on black money.

The PMLA Special court has summoned Vijay Mallya and others on August 27, taking cognisance of the Enforcement Directorate (ED) plea to bring back Mallya under the new Economic Offender's Bill. As per the ED application, Mallya owes banks around Rs 9,990 crore, as of May 2018.

If Mallya does not appear before the designated court within the given time, he will be declared as a 'fugitive' and ED will move to confiscate his assets worth Rs 12,500 crore, the court stated.
